What Is RTP?

RTP refers to the percentage of all wagered money that a slot game returns to players over time. For example, if a slot has an RTP of 96%, it theoretically returns $96 for every $100 wagered. It’s crucial to understand that this is a long-term average, not a guarantee for individual sessions.

Why RTP Matters

Higher RTP slots generally offer better odds for players. Most reputable online casinos feature slots with RTPs ranging from 94% to 98%. While this might seem like a small difference, over extended play periods, even a 1-2% variance can impact your overall results.

Important Reminders

Remember that RTP doesn’t guarantee individual session outcomes. Slot machines use random number generators (RNGs), meaning each spin is independent. You could hit a big win on a low-RTP game or experience losses on high-RTP slots.
